The Volunteer State officially commenced legal sports betting on <strong>November 1, 2020<\/strong>, following the passage of the Tennessee Sports Gaming Act in 2019. This legislative decision established a regulatory framework that is distinctively focused on digital access, eschewing the traditional retail sportsbook model entirely. The market is overseen by the Tennessee Sports Wagering Council (SWAC), which is tasked with ensuring regulatory compliance, promoting responsible gaming, and managing the licensing of all operators. The SWAC&#8217;s regulatory authority was expanded to include fantasy sports through Public Chapter 143, which became law in July 2023. This oversight ensures that the burgeoning DFS sector operates with the same integrity and consumer protection standards as the sports betting market.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Several major DFS and pick&#8217;em operators are approved licensees, including <strong>DraftKings<\/strong>, <strong>FanDuel<\/strong>, <strong>Underdog Sports<\/strong>, and <strong>SidePrize LLC (dba PrizePicks)<\/strong>. The initial bill, passed without the signature of Governor Bill Lee, created a market that was unique in two significant ways: the online-only mandate and a controversial mandatory hold percentage.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The most notable regulatory hurdle was the requirement for <a href=\"https:\/\/www.squawka.com\/us\/bet\/betting-sites\/\">sportsbooks<\/a> to maintain a <strong>10% minimum hold<\/strong> on all wagers annually. This rule, which effectively capped the amount operators could pay out to 90% of the handle, was designed to ensure a predictable tax revenue stream for the state. However, it was widely criticized by operators and industry analysts for potentially limiting competition and offering less favorable odds to consumers.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In a significant legislative shift, the state eliminated the mandatory hold requirement in July 2023 and simultaneously transitioned the tax structure from a 20% levy on Adjusted Gross Income (AGI) to a <strong>1.85% tax on the total handle<\/strong> (the total amount wagered). This change made Tennessee the first state in the nation to tax the handle rather than the revenue, a move that provides the state with a more stable, albeit lower, tax base, regardless of the operators&#8217; profitability. This absence is the primary reason the state was able to launch an online-only market without the political and legal complexities often associated with tribal exclusivity over casino gaming.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The state&#8217;s unique characteristics are further defined by its passionate sports culture, anchored by several major professional franchises: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>National Football League (NFL):<\/strong> Tennessee Titans (Nashville)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>National Basketball Association (NBA):<\/strong> Memphis Grizzlies (Memphis)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>National Hockey League (NHL):<\/strong> Nashville Predators (Nashville)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ong><a href=\"https:\/\/www.squawka.com\/us\/mls\/\">Major League Soccer<\/a> (MLS):<\/strong> Nashville SC (Nashville) \u00a0<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p>The presence of these teams, particularly the Titans and Predators in the capital city of Nashville, provides a strong local betting interest that fuels the mobile-only market.
